Mount Vernon council: what passed and what moved forward
At its meeting, the Mount Vernon City Council recorded votes on multiple ordinances and advanced additional measures for later consideration.

Adopted items
- Ordinance 2026-11 (vehicle storage): Adopted after a motion, second and roll-call unanimous affirmative votes. (Introduced as an amendment to city codified ordinances on vehicle storage.)
- Ordinance 2026-13 (zoning reclassification): Adopted to change two parcel classifications from R1 single-family residential to GB general business district; council members said no public opposition was heard and voted yes.
- Ordinance 2026-17 (backflow protection): Council suspended the rules, moved the ordinance to a final reading and adopted it as an emergency measure (see separate article for technical explanation).

Items moved forward without final adoption
- Resolution 2026-63: Received its first reading; described as supporting abolition of the Clinton Township Water and Sewer District and related governance matters. A committee meeting request was noted.
- Ordinance 2026-20 (compensation, hours and benefits for certain employees): Given first reading; council scheduled short and longer committee meetings in June for additional review.

Procedural notes
Council used roll-call votes for adopted ordinances and announced adoption when records showed unanimous yes responses among members present. Where committee follow-up was requested, staff were asked to provide details at upcoming meetings.
